As the sole owner of a motor vehicle, watercraft, or outboard motor, an individual may designate a beneficiary or beneficiaries to an ohio title with a signed and notarized affidavit to designate a beneficiary (form bmv 3811) submitted to a county clerk of courts title office. Complete and mail an application(s) for certificate of title to a motor vehicle (form bmv 3774) to the county clerk of courts title office that issued the title.

Ohio motor vehicle power of attorney (form bmv 3771) is a standard form to designate someone to represent a vehicle owner before the bureau of motor vehicles.
